GOLF CLUB HEADS WITH OPTIMIZED CHARACTERISTICS AND RELATED METHODS

  • US 20190321702A1
  • Filed: 07/03/2019
  • Published: 10/24/2019
  • Est. Priority Date: 03/14/2013
  • Status: Active Grant

1. A golf club head comprising:

  • a head body comprising;

    a head front portion;

    a head rear portion;

    a head heel portion;

    a head toe portion;

    a head sole portion;

    a head top portion; and

    a hosel structure having a bore for receiving a golf club shaft, the bore having a hosel axis;

    a face portion at the head front portion and comprising;

    a strikeface centerpoint;

    a strikeface perimeter; and

    a face height bounded by the strikeface perimeter, the strikeface centerpoint positioned at a midpoint of the face height;

    a head center of gravity; and

    a weight structure located towards the sole portion and the rear portion of the head body, the weight structure having a weight center;

    at least one of;

    a first performance characteristic;

    or a second performance characteristic;

    a third performance characteristic;

    wherein;

    when the golf club head is at an address position over a ground plane;

    a head vertical axis extends through the head center of gravity and is orthogonal to the ground plane; and

    a head horizontal axis extends through the head center of gravity, and is orthogonal to the head vertical axis;

    a loft plane of the golf club head is tangent to the strikeface centerpoint;

    a front plane of the golf club head extends through the strikeface centerpoint, parallel to the hosel axis, and orthogonal to the ground plane;

    a head depth plane extends through the strikeface centerpoint, parallel to the head horizontal axis and perpendicular to the loft plane;

    a CG height axis extends through the head center of gravity and intersects the head depth plane perpendicularly at a first intersection point;

    a head CG height of the head center of gravity is measured, along the CG height axis, between the head center of gravity and the first intersection point;

    a head CG depth of the head center of gravity is measured, parallel to the ground plane and orthogonal to the front plane, between;

    a second intersection point located at an intersection between the front plane and the ground plane; and

    a third intersection point located at an intersection between the head vertical axis and the ground plane;

    the head CG depth is approximately 25 mm to approximately 102 mm;

    the face height is approximately 33 mm to approximately 71 mm, measured parallel to the loft plane;

    the first performance characteristic comprises;

    the head CG height being less than or equal to approximately 5.08 mm;

    the second performance characteristic comprises;

    a CG performance ratio of less than or equal to 0.56, as defined by (a) 76.2 mm minus the face height, divided by an absolute value of the head CG height;

    the third performance characteristic comprises;

    (a) the head volume magnitude added to (b) a ratio between the head CG depth divided by an absolute value of the head CG height;

    wherein the third performance characteristic is greater than or equal to 425 cc.
